  About the Network


About the Network

Welcome to the System iNetwork! The System iNetwork is a comprehensive collection of resources for System i professionals brought to you by Penton Technology Media, publisher of these fine magazines and many more:

  • System iNEWS, the #1 System i magazine worldwide
  • Windows IT Pro, the #1 Windows IT magazine worldwide
  • SQL Server Magazine, the only magazine for SQL Server professionals
  • Business Finance, the leading magazine for CFOs, accountants, controllers, and other financial professionals

The goal of the System iNetwork is to provide you with a single source for all your AS/400, iSeries, and System i needs, including:

  • Current System i news and analysis
  • Strategic coverage of AS/400-iSeries-System i issues and technologies
  • Product and vendor information to help you make educated purchasing decisions
  • Technical tips, how-to articles, and discussion forums for developers, network specialists, DBAs, and anyone else working with the AS/400-iSeries-System i
  • Help locating an event in your geographic area or topic of interest
  • Assistance navigating IBM's Web site offerings and online documentation
  • Assistance in fulfilling all your AS/400-iSeries-System i educational needs
